The Expense of Overlooking Minor Repairs and Preventive Maintenance

Ignoring regular maintenance and basic repairs can bring about significant long-term expenses for vehicle owners. When small issues, such as worn brake pads or a slight fluid leak, are neglected, they can escalate into considerably graver problems. For instance, neglecting a simple oil change can bring about engine wear, finally demanding an expensive replacement. Furthermore, failing to resolve minor electrical problems may lead to complete system failures, costing considerably more than the initial repair would have.

Regular visits to an auto mechanic allow for timely interventions that prevent these costly breakdowns. Car owners might discover that the accumulated expenses of postponed fixes greatly surpass the costs linked to regular upkeep. Furthermore, neglecting these problems may additionally reduce the car's resale worth, resulting in owners having a devalued asset. In the long term, regular servicing not only improves automobile durability but also preserves the owner's fiscal commitment.

Benefits of Engine Longevity

While some vehicle owners might dismiss oil changes as a basic maintenance task, these regular services play a critical role in enhancing engine longevity. Scheduled oil changes ensure that the engine is adequately lubricated, lessening friction and wear on its moving parts. Clean oil effectively removes contaminants that can gather over time, inhibiting sludge buildup and potential engine damage. By maintaining proper oil levels and quality, vehicle owners can avert overheating and excessive wear, creating a longer-lasting engine. In addition, a well-maintained engine functions more smoothly, lowering the likelihood of costly repairs. In the long run, investing in regular oil changes proves to be a wise choice, as it extends engine life and lessens the risk of unexpected expenses stemming from engine failure.

How Proper Tire Maintenance Saves You Money

Proper tire care is crucial for vehicle owners aiming to cut costs in the long run. Adequately maintained tires enhance fuel efficiency by guaranteeing optimal traction and reducing rolling resistance. When tires are see guide properly inflated and aligned, vehicles consume less fuel, translating to lower gas expenditures over time.

Additionally, regular tire rotations and alignments can considerably extend tire durability, deferring the need for costly replacements. Irregular wear can lead to premature tire failure, leading to unexpected expenses and potential dangers on the road.

Buying tires with adequate tread depth also enhances performance and reduces the risk of accidents. Drivers who overlook their tires may face not only higher fuel costs but also expenses associated with repairs resulting from tire-related issues.

How Often Should I Plan Visits to My Auto Mechanic?

Normally, arranging check-ups to an auto mechanic every 6 months or 5,000 miles is advisable. However, individual vehicle requirements and usage may call for adjustments, making it important to consult the vehicle's maintenance recommendations for specific information.

What Can I Expect During a Standard Vehicle Inspection?

In a standard vehicle examination, individuals should expect checks on liquid levels, brakes, tires, lights, and belts. Technicians might deliver a report describing any necessary repairs or maintenance, guaranteeing the vehicle remains safe and operational.

Are There Certain Symptoms That Show I Need to Consult a Mechanic?

Particular symptoms signal a need for a mechanic, including odd noises, warning lights on the dashboard, fluid leaks, diminished performance, or strange odors. Dealing with these concerns immediately can help prevent more extensive and costly repairs later.
